Frank van Bodegraven is a leading researcher in marine renewable energy, with a primary focus on wave energy harvesting and the development of novel wave energy converters (WECs). His major contributions center on the design and potential of the AE-Wave Hexapod WEC, a cutting-edge system tailored for the harsh conditions of the North Sea. In his most-cited work (2024, 10 citations), van Bodegraven demonstrates how this device can efficiently capture energy from both gravitational water waves and short wind/swell waves, addressing a key challenge in the field. His research bridges theoretical hydrodynamics and practical engineering, offering scalable solutions for offshore energy generation. Though early in his citation impact, van Bodegraven’s work is notable for its direct relevance to Europe’s blue economy goals and its potential to reduce reliance on fossil fuels. His achievements include advancing the understanding of wave-structure interactions and proposing a robust, hexapod-based design that could significantly lower the levelized cost of wave energy.
